Jaboatão dos Guararapes, PE, Brazil, 04 de maio de 2015. - ------------------------------ - ------------------------------ Subject: caracter display problems in Virtual Terminals F1-F6 - ------------------------------ - ------------------------------ So, the problem is that some caracters was not being displayed correctly in the six Virtual Terminals (F1-F6). Take a look on some exemples below: output of the command <cp -v teste1.txt teste5.txt>: “teste1.txt” -> “teste5.txt” output of the command <cp -v screenlog.0 ~/>: “screenlog.0” -> “/home/jamenson/screenlog.0” output of the command <mv -v teste* ~/>: “teste1.txt” -> “/home/jamenson/teste1.txt” “teste2.txt” -> “/home/jamenson/teste2.txt” “teste3.txt” -> “/home/jamenson/teste3.txt” “teste4.txt” -> “/home/jamenson/teste4.txt” “teste5.txt” -> “/home/jamenson/teste5.txt” output of the command <rm -v ~/teste*>: removido “/home/jamenson/teste1.txt” removido “/home/jamenson/teste2.txt” removido “/home/jamenson/teste3.txt” removido “/home/jamenson/teste4.txt” removido “/home/jamenson/teste5.txt” - ------------------------------ - ------------------------------ Here in my six Virtual Terminals (F1-F6), instead of a " (ASCII code 034), the sistem is generating a þ caracter (ASCII code 254). I also realized that in Emulated Virtual Terminals in Debian GNU/Linux 8 (Jessy) - inside the X Server - the problem does not arise. I just mentioned Debian GNU/Linux 8 (Jessy) here because they migrated recently from SysV to systemd init scheme, so I thing it is a relevant comparison. - ------------------------------ - ------------------------------ Adicionaly, the caracter ã if not being displayed. As most of you already had notice, here in Brazil and there in Portugal we must use the ã caracter due to orthografic rules requirements. - ------------------------------ - ------------------------------ To solve such a problems, the mentioned configuration is mandatory, at least by now, especially: # CONFIG_DRM_I915 is not set # CONFIG_DRM_I915_KMS is not set # CONFIG_DRM_I915_FBDEV is not set # CONFIG_DRM_I915_PRELIMINARY_HW_SUPPORT is not set - ------------------------------ - ------------------------------ In GNU/Debian 8 (Jessy), the original configuration is: CONFIG_DRM_NOUVEAU=m CONFIG_NOUVEAU_DEBUG=5 CONFIG_NOUVEAU_DEBUG_DEFAULT=3 CONFIG_DRM_NOUVEAU_BACKLIGHT=y CONFIG_DRM_I915=m CONFIG_DRM_I915_KMS=y CONFIG_DRM_I915_FBDEV=y # CONFIG_DRM_I915_PRELIMINARY_HW_SUPPORT is not set It does not work correctly. Even if you thing that the correct module will be loaded by the kernel, even so, it does not work correctly, at least by now. - ------------------------------ - ------------------------------ I hope be clarified the goal of this post.
